你查询的IP:[118.126.53.126]  地理位置:中国–上海–上海臣翊网络数据中心

最新查询122.96.212.156 218.56.169.112 123.253.26.222 124.64.125.145 123.137.113.57 125.216.61.119 221.198.10.237 124.20.135.171 124.160.231.76 118.126.53.126 116.242.95.4 119.31.192.101 117.72.82.235 121.59.206.154 121.248.125.116 221.192.25.222 117.76.39.159 122.112.181.198 123.98.3.193 61.240.17.227 116.214.64.14 220.232.64.95 202.143.16.187 125.215.219.67 116.199.235.246 119.62.25.165 119.32.93.253 121.40.49.212 202.170.128.64 203.171.224.183 120.92.78.95